1. What is a Security Engineer at AIRBUS U.S. Space & Defense?
As a Security Engineer at AIRBUS U.S. Space & Defense, you are the frontline defender of some of the most advanced aerospace and defense technologies in the world. This role goes far beyond standard enterprise IT security. You are tasked with safeguarding critical infrastructure, secure satellite communications, and sensitive defense contracts from sophisticated threat actors. Your work directly ensures the integrity and resilience of systems that governments and commercial partners rely on for mission-critical operations.
The impact of this position is massive. You will collaborate with cross-functional engineering teams to embed security into the lifecycle of next-generation space and defense products. Whether you are hardening Linux-based ground control systems, securing cloud-native satellite data processing pipelines, or defending complex network architectures, your contributions dictate the safety and reliability of the AIRBUS fleet and its associated defense platforms.
Expect a highly dynamic, complex, and deeply rewarding environment. You will be navigating strict compliance frameworks, engaging in proactive threat modeling, and solving unprecedented security challenges at an aerospace scale. This role requires a blend of deep technical acumen, strategic foresight, and an unwavering commitment to the AIRBUS U.S. Space & Defense mission of pioneering sustainable aerospace for a safe and united world.
